Ankündigung

Einklappen
Keine Ankündigung bisher.

Kann mich nicht in´s Admin- Menü Einloggen

Einklappen

Neue Werbung 2019

Einklappen
X
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Kann mich nicht in´s Admin- Menü Einloggen

    Hallo,

    ich kann mich einfach nicht in das Admin- Menü Einloggen.

    Hier ist meine passwd.inc.php

    PHP-Code:
    <?


    // Der Hostname Ihrer Datenbank, z.B. localhost oder so, wie hier als Beispiel eingetragen
    $DbHost     = "localhost";

     // The database you are going to use
    $DbDatabase = "ahaus";

    // Ihr Datenbank-Benutzername
    $DbUser     = "root";

    // ...und das Passwort
    $DbPassword = "****";

    //Dies ist das Passwort für den Admin-Bereich
    $AdminPasswd = "testadmin";

    ?>
    und hier ist die LogIn.php

    PHP-Code:
    <?php
    require('C:/xampp/htdocs/ahaus/includes/messages.inc.php');
       require(
    'C:/xampp/htdocs/ahaus/includes/config.inc.php');


       if(
    $loginfail){
         
    $ERR "ERR_044";
       }
       if(
    $action){
         if(
    $passwd == $AdminPasswd){
           
    setcookie("authenticated","1",0,"","",0);
           
    Header("Location: admin.php");
         }else{
           
    $ERR "ERR_026";
         }
       }

    ?>

    ....
    ....
    Könnt ihr mir vllt. sagen, warum ich mich nicht einloggen kann?

    MfG


  • #2
    Sry, meine Glskugel ist leider grade in reperatur. Kommt ne Fehlermeldung, wenn ja welche?

    Und zeig mal komplettes Script .

    Kommentar


    • #3
      Nein

      Hi,

      leider kommt keine Fehlermeldung... Ob das nun so sein muss oder net keine Ahnung^^

      Hier ist LogIn.php

      PHP-Code:
      <?php
      require('C:/xampp/htdocs/ahaus/includes/messages.inc.php');
         require(
      'C:/xampp/htdocs/ahaus/includes/config.inc.php');


         if(
      $loginfail){
           
      $ERR "ERR_044";
         }
         if(
      $action){
           if(
      $passwd == $AdminPasswd){
             
      setcookie("authenticated","1",0,"","",0);
             
      Header("Location: admin.php");
           }else{
             
      $ERR "ERR_026";
           }
         }

      ?>

      <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
      <html>
      <head>
      <title>Abix Tristar-Pro Administration</title>
      <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">

      <style type="text/css">
      <!--
      .Stil1 {
          font-family: Arial, Helvetica, sans-serif;
          font-weight: bold;
          color: #FFFFFF;
      }
      .Stil2 {
          font-family: Verdana, Arial, Helvetica, sans-serif;
          font-weight: bold;
      }
      .Stil3 {
          font-family: Arial, Helvetica, sans-serif;
          color: #FF0000;
          font-style: italic;
          font-size: 12px;
      }
      -->
      </style>
      </head>

      <body>
      <? require("./header.php"); ?>


      <table width="700" align="center" cellpadding="0" cellspacing="0" bgcolor="#FFFFFF" style="border:1px solid #336699; border-collapse: collapse">
        <!--DWLayoutTable-->
        <tr>
          <td height="74" colspan="3" align="center" valign="middle" bgcolor="#3A5FB1"><span class="Stil1">Willkommen zum Administrations-Men&uuml;. <br>
          Bitte geben Sie ihr Admin-Passwort ein und klicken Sie anschliessend auf den Button Login </span></td>
        </tr>
        <tr>
          <td width="46" height="55">&nbsp;</td>
          <td width="599" align="center" valign="middle"><FONT FACE="Verdana, Verdana, Arial, Helvetica, sans-serif" SIZE="2" COLOR=red>
              <b><? print $$ERR; ?></b></td>
          <td width="47">&nbsp;</td>
        </tr><? if(!$action || ($action && $ERR)) : ?><FORM NAME=login ACTION=login.php METHOD=POST>
        <tr>
          <td height="31" colspan="3" valign="top"><table width="100%" border="0" cellpadding="0" cellspacing="0">
            <!--DWLayoutTable-->
            <tr>
              <td width="192" height="29" align="center" valign="middle" bgcolor="#E1F4FF"><span class="Stil2">Passwort:</span></td>
          <td width="2">&nbsp;</td>
            <td width="252" valign="middle" bgcolor="#E1F4FF"><INPUT TYPE=password NAME=passwd SIZE=20>
              <img src="../bilder/secu.gif" width="12" height="15"> </td>
        <td width="2">&nbsp;</td>
            <td width="248" valign="middle" bgcolor="#E1F4FF"><INPUT TYPE=submit NAME=action VALUE="Login &gt;"> </td>
        </tr>
          </table></td>
        </tr></form><? endif; ?>
        <tr align="center" valign="middle">
          <td height="39" colspan="3" bgcolor="#F7F7F7"><span class="Stil3"><img src="../bilder/ausr.gif" width="28" height="28" align="absmiddle"> Bitte dr&uuml;cken Sie nicht auf Enter, klicken Sie mit der Maus auf Login </span></td>
        </tr>
        <tr>
          <td height="111">&nbsp;</td>
          <td>&nbsp;</td>
          <td>&nbsp;</td>
        </tr>
      </table>

      </TD>
      </TR>
      <tr>
        <td height="238"></td>
      </tr>
      </TABLE>

      <!-- Closing external table (header.php) -->
      </TD>
      </TR>
      </TABLE>


      <? require("./footer.php"); ?>
      </BODY>
      </HTML>

      Kommentar


      • #4
        PHP-Code:
        $passwd == $AdminPasswd 
        Wo sind den die bestimmt? Bzw. die zweite sehe ich ja, aber die erste, wie wird die den übergeben. Eigentlich sollte die doch mit Post übergeben werden. Überseh ich das grade oder wurden die so willkürlich gewählt.

        Kommentar


        • #5


          Hi,

          keine Ahnung.. ich habs das Script nur so bekommen wie es ist. Es ist auch eine Anleitung dabei. dort steht aber nur, das man sich eben mit dem PW einloggen soll, wie es in der passwd.inc.php steht

          Kommentar


          • #6
            Sind das wirklich alle Datein?

            Kommentar


            • #7
              hi,

              nein um Gottes willen, das sind nicht alle Dateien.... Das ist ein komplettes Script für eine Website.

              Wieso geht das nur nicht

              Kommentar


              • #8
                Noch eine Frage, Hast du an dem Script irgendwas bearbeitet?

                Kommentar


                • #9
                  hi,

                  nein ich habe das script nicht bearbeitet...

                  Ausser eben die Einstellungen für die Datenbank etc.

                  Kommentar


                  • #10
                    [MOD: verschoben]
                    --

                    „Emoticons machen einen Beitrag etwas freundlicher. Deine wirken zwar fachlich richtig sein, aber meist ziemlich uninteressant.
                    Wenn man nur Text sieht, haben viele junge Entwickler keine interesse, diese stumpfen Texte zu lesen.“


                    --

                    Kommentar


                    • #11
                      Vergiss das Script das ist so mies Programmiert und vorallem dann noch unsicher.

                      Kommt nee fehlermeldung beim ausführen des Scriptes?

                      require('C:/xampp/htdocs/ahaus/includes/messages.inc.php');
                      require(
                      'C:/xampp/htdocs/ahaus/includes/config.inc.php');
                      Nett das zwar der lokale pfad dort drin steht bewirkt aber das es garantiert auf keinen anderen Server läuft ohne manuele anpassung. Den Jeder Server hat das in einen anderen Verzeichniss liegen oder anderen Laufwerk muß net immer C sein bzw wenn dann ein Linux Server ist dort gibst keine Laufwerke.

                      Mfg Splasch

                      Kommentar


                      • #12
                        abix nur 1&1 server funktiniert nicht strato und viele andren
                        wenn Sie noch nicht instaliert haben senden sie script zu mein email dann kann ich für Sie vorbereiten sari_s@web.de
                        Mit freundlichen Grüßen
                        Sari Sezai

                        Kommentar


                        • #13
                          HTML-Code:
                          <INPUT TYPE=submit NAME=action VALUE="Login &gt;">
                          PHP-Code:
                          if($action){ 
                          Mal abgesehen von dem invaliden HTML-Code verlangt das Script register globals = on.

                          Schmeiß das weg und besorg/schreib dir ein neues.
                          PHP-Code:
                          if ($var != 0) {
                            
                          $var 0;

                          Kommentar


                          • #14
                            das ganze Script müffelt arg nach register globals = ON ..

                            HTML-Code:
                            <INPUT TYPE=password NAME=passwd SIZE=20>
                            PHP-Code:

                            if ($passwd==$AdminPW
                            also erstmal gehören Attribute zu HTML-Tags in Quotes - bevorzugt Double-Quotes, und dann sollte eigentlich alles klein geschrieben sein - INSBESONDERE TAGS und Attribut-Namen ....

                            und an den Stellen, wo $passwd steht .. musst du halt passend ersetzen . Entweder überall im Code oder aber einmal

                            PHP-Code:
                            if (isset($_REQUEST['passwd']))
                               
                            $passwd=$_REQUEST['passwd']; 
                            "Irren ist männlich", sprach der Igel und stieg von der Drahtbürste

                            Kommentar


                            • #15
                              Ich glaub es lohnt sich nicht dieses Skript weiter zu nutzen, das sieht nicht aus als wenn es nur ein Problem hätte ... nehm lieber etwas anderes, damit wirst du sicherlich nicht Glücklich.

                              Kommentar

                              Lädt...
                              X